I see there are a few similar questions around this point but I am still struggling with getting a 4th axis working

 

For me the first thing was to cancel CYCLE800 that the XYZ LR1000 didnt like, which was easy with the check boxes on the pre post screen.

 

After that. TRAORI appeared.
Again the machine didn’t like it so I unchecked the TCP box in the machine kinematics area under the A axis

 

After that FGROUP (X, Y, Z, A) and FGREF[A] appears in the post. Which again the machine didn’t like.

 

Ive also altered the definemachine portion of the post to suit a previous question that was asked in the forum all to no avail.

 

I think the machine just needs gcode G0 moves. 

Does anyone have a working post for a Siemens 828D control with a GSA 4th axis, or any other advice and ideas I could try to get this working please.

My answers are typically not correct but I can try to recommend some strategies and hopefully not be too far off.

First, I assume you are setting your WCS at the center of rotation, either A/C or B/C. That would be a requirement if you aren't going to use CYCLE800 or TRAORI as those require kinematic calculations to be performed by the machine. Is that the case?

 

Next, how about just leaving TCP checked and manually commenting out the TRAORI call to test if the positioning seems correct.
